STK星座的简单覆盖性分析

STK星座的简单覆盖性分析

一:对单颗卫星进行覆盖性分析

STK可以对单颗卫星或者整个星座来进行局域和全球的覆盖性分析

1.1创立一颗卫星

点击上方Insert,选择satelite,进行默认设置
双击进行默认的星座的设置
在这里插入图片描述
这里笔者设置的是90度倾角和700km轨道高度,点击apply进行设置
设置好的3D和2D场景图如图下所示
在这里插入图片描述
在这里插入图片描述

1.2创建所需分析的目标区域

进行覆盖分析还要设置卫星的天线波束的一个宽度

同样再insert中选择Sensor进行添加一个卫星的天线(传感器设备)双击之后选择需要添加的卫星,点击ok进行设置完成
在这里插入图片描述

接下来要对目标区域的覆盖分析,插入目标区域,
在这里插入图片描述
在左方会出现一个如下的一个目标区域
在这里插入图片描述
双击进行设置:默认是对全经度,纬度从南纬60-北纬70,右方Grid definition 是对目标区域进行一个网格划分,默认是6°一个划分网格,一般网格划分越小越精准,不然会导致这个6*6度的网格有一点被覆盖到就算到覆盖的分子中,影响最后得出的结果,设置好点击左下方的apply进行设置完成。

在这里插入图片描述
设置网格划分之后要进行需要分析的卫星的添加设置,点击卫星的传感器(天线),之后点击右方的Assign,再进行Apply设置。

1.3添加所需对目标区域覆盖性分析的卫星

在这里插入图片描述

之后STK需要进行对这一系列进行计算
点击上方的红线部分,会出现一个compute access,进行对网格计算
在这里插入图片描述
计算完成2D图中就会出现一系列的栅格划分在这里插入图片描述

1.4产生覆盖分析报告或图表

最后进行这个卫星对设置的-60°到70°的覆盖性分析
右击左方的目标区域会出现Report&Graph Manger,里面会有一些STK自带的覆盖分析报告和图标,一般需求对这个目标区域的覆盖百分比和经纬度的覆盖情况:
在这里插入图片描述

左方是设置采样的起始时间,点击Specify Time Properties进行蛇者,下方step size就是设置覆盖的步长时间,当然步长越小越精准,越大越粗糙,因为相当于这个卫星在60s之内所扫过的区域都会算在覆盖分析中,增大的覆盖性能,步长越小,计算量也会越大,等待周期也就越长(建议电脑性能一般的步长设置长一些,不然会引起电脑死机)
笔者在这里展示一下在这一段时间内这颗卫星对目标区域覆盖的百分比:
在这里插入图片描述
下方是在这段时间内对目标区域覆盖的最大百分比和最小百分比以及平均的一个覆盖百分比。除了有报告还有图表,也可以将这一报告导出txt文件后使用MATLAB对其进行画图分析,

二:建立星座对其覆盖分析

对星座的覆盖性分析方法和对一颗卫星的覆盖性分析方法大致相同,重要的是如何建立自己想要的一个星座,STK提供了快捷的建立星座的方法,就是使用某一个卫星当种子,使用其轨道参数(轨道高度,轨道倾角和携带的天线波束的宽度),具体操作就是在左方对种子卫星右击选择satelite在选择walker tool。上方seed satellite就是种子卫星,可以进行更改,有三种星座形状可以选择,Walker star(极轨道星座)卫星网络,Walker delta(倾斜星座)卫星网络, 一般来说delta倾斜轨道选择,极地选star。下面就是设置轨道平面和轨道面的卫星数(可根据自己建立的星座来设置,这里笔者为了减小计算量设置的是2*2极地星座):
在这里插入图片描述
建立好的星座就像下图所示:
在这里插入图片描述
让星座对之前设置的目标区域覆盖分析还需要在目标区域中添加这一整个星座(可见1.3,加入相应卫星的sensor),再进行compute accesse:
在这里插入图片描述
之后进行的覆盖性分析操作如1.4一样,对应自己的需求导出相应的报告。
(STK也可以进行较为复杂的覆盖性分析计算,如在地面站通信仰角的约束下、在地面站通信距离约束下及其他约束的覆盖性的分析)
(学生的学习分享)

  • 21
    点赞
  • 91
    收藏
    觉得还不错? 一键收藏
  • 3
    评论
评论 3
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值